How do you handle conflict resolution in multi-master database replication?
Managing conflicts in multi-master database replication is crucial for maintaining data consistency and system reliability. In such setups, multiple servers, known as masters, can read and write data simultaneously, which can lead to conflicts. For example, if two masters try to update the same data at the same time, the system needs a method to resolve this conflict. Understanding the strategies to handle these conflicts is essential for database administrators and developers working with replicated databases.